what is the term for the pressure exerted by the vapor of liquid until the vapor and the liquid are in equilibrium
The term for the pressure exerted by the vapor of a liquid until equilibrium with the liquid is reached is called vapor pressure.
Vapor pressure is the pressure exerted by the vapor of a substance when the vapor and the liquid are in a state of dynamic equilibrium. In a closed system, when a liquid evaporates, its molecules transition from the liquid phase to the gas phase. As these gas molecules accumulate above the liquid surface, they exert a pressure on the liquid, creating the vapor pressure.
Vapor pressure is temperature-dependent and increases with an increase in temperature. This is because higher temperatures provide more energy to the liquid molecules, allowing more molecules to escape from the liquid phase into the gas phase. Conversely, at lower temperatures, fewer molecules have sufficient energy to escape, resulting in a lower vapor pressure.
Vapor pressure plays a crucial role in various phenomena, such as evaporation, boiling, and condensation. It is also important in fields like thermodynamics, phase equilibrium, and the behavior of volatile substances.

give the term for the amount of solute in moles per kilogram of solvent.
Molality is term used for the amount of solute in moles per kilogram of solvent.
Generally, molality (m) is defined as the number of moles of solute per kilogram of solvent.
The formula for molality is given as:
Molality (m) = moles of solute / kilograms of solvent.
Students must remember that molality is used to measure the moles in relation to the mass of the solvent and not the mass of the solution.
Molality can also be defined as the “total moles of a solute contained in a kilogram of a solvent.” The other name of molality is also known as molal concentration which is a measure of solute concentration in a solution.

what is the predominant intermolecular force in the liquid state of each of these compounds: hydrogen fluoride ( hf ), carbon tetrachloride ( ccl4 ), and methyl chloride ( ch3cl )?
The intermolecular forces in HF, \(CCl_4\) and \(CH_3Cl\) molecules are hydrogen bonding, dispersion forces and dipole-dipole interactions respectively.
Intermolecular forces, such as the electromagnetic forces of attraction or repulsion that act between atoms in a molecule and other kinds of nearby particles, such as atoms or ions, mediate interactions between molecules.
The attractive forces that occur between molecules are known as intermolecular forces. They control a number of bulk characteristics, including the solubilities (miscibilities) of compounds and their melting and boiling temperatures.
Intermolecular forces may be divided into four categories: hydrogen bonding, London dispersion forces, ion-dipole, and dipole-dipole.
HF has a hydrogen bond, also known as an H-bond, is an electrically charged attraction between an electronegative atom containing a single pair of electrons, known as the hydrogen bond acceptor, and a hydrogen (H) atom that is covalently attached to a more electronegative "donor" atom or group.
\(CCl_4\) has London dispersion forces which is the least powerful intermolecular force. When the electrons in two nearby atoms hold positions that cause the atoms to temporarily form dipoles, the consequence is the London dispersion force, a transient attractive attraction.
\(CH_3Cl\) has dipole-dipole interactions where molecules having permanent dipoles are drawn to one another electrostatically; for example, the positive end of one molecule will attract the negative end of another, and so forth, eventually causing the molecules to align.

Purpose of steps in crystallisation of organic solid
The purpose of steps in crystallization of organic solid is to obtain pure crystals of the desired compound.
Crystallization is a technique for separating substances based on their solubility properties. It is a commonly used technique in the chemical industry for separating chemical compounds from a solution or a mixture. The purpose of steps in crystallization of organic solid is to obtain pure crystals of the desired compound. Here are the steps involved in crystallization:
Dissolving the solid: The organic solid is dissolved in a suitable solvent to form a saturated solution.
Filtration: The solution is filtered to remove any insoluble impurities that might be present.
Cooling: The solution is cooled slowly and carefully to allow the crystals to form.
Crystallization: The crystals are collected by filtration or decantation.
Drying: The crystals are dried in a desiccator to remove any residual solvent.
These steps ensure that the crystals obtained are pure and of a high quality. The slow cooling process is particularly important, as it allows the crystals to form in a controlled manner, which helps to ensure their purity. The drying process is also important, as it helps to remove any residual solvent that might be present, which can affect the purity of the crystals.
